Transaction 74a5b8702913c9973b97233f24f27708f295206354b7ea1721439789fd354ae3
1 Input
2 Outputs
- 74a5b8702913c9973b97233f24f27708f295206354b7ea1721439789fd354ae3:0
- 74a5b8702913c9973b97233f24f27708f295206354b7ea1721439789fd354ae3:1
value 257435
address 3NuUxApKiNEXhW4fQbHynniu1zHCaR9TQ8
value 4386877
address 16h1AL1hkPCZyL8iBhPmXNaw3dJbrPr48R